免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

小程序vue转化的原理和详细步骤

小程序是近年来兴起的一种移动端应用,它具有轻量、快速、易用等优点,受到越来越多的开发者的青睐。而Vue.js则是一款流行的前端框架,它提供了一系列的API和工具,使得开发者可以更加高效地构建Web应用。在这篇文章中,我们将介绍小程序Vue转化的原理和详细步骤。

一、小程序与Vue.js的区别

在介绍小程序Vue转化之前,我们需要先了解一下小程序和Vue.js的区别。小程序是一种基于微信平台的轻量级应用,它具有独立的生命周期和UI渲染机制,开发者需要使用微信提供的API和组件来构建小程序。而Vue.js则是一款前端框架,它可以用于构建Web应用,提供了一系列的API和工具,使得开发者可以更加高效地构建Web应用。

二、小程序Vue转化的原理

小程序Vue转化的原理是将Vue.js的组件转化为小程序的组件,实现两种不同框架之间的互通。在转化过程中,需要解决以下几个问题:

1. 小程序和Vue.js的生命周期不同,需要进行适配转换。

2. 小程序和Vue.js的UI渲染机制不同,需要进行适配转换。

3. 小程序和Vue.js的组件系统不同,需要进行适配转换。

三、小程序Vue转化的详细步骤

下面我们将详细介绍小程序Vue转化的步骤:

1. 安装小程序Vue转化工具

目前市面上有多种小程序Vue转化工具,例如mpvue、wepy等。这些工具都可以将Vue.js的组件转化为小程序的组件,使得开发者可以在小程序中使用Vue.js的API和工具。

2. 创建Vue.js组件

在使用小程序Vue转化工具之前,我们需要先创建Vue.js的组件。Vue.js的组件可以使用Vue.js提供的API和工具进行构建,具有灵活性和可复用性。

3. 安装小程序开发工具

在使用小程序Vue转化工具之前,我们需要先安装小程序开发工具。小程序开发工具可以用于编写和调试小程序,具有丰富的调试工具和API。

4. 使用小程序Vue转化工具

在安装小程序Vue转化工具之后,我们可以使用它将Vue.js的组件转化为小程序的组件。具体的步骤如下:

(1)在Vue.js组件中引入小程序Vue转化工具,例如mpvue或wepy。

(2)使用小程序Vue转化工具将Vue.js组件转化为小程序组件。

(3)在小程序中使用转化后的组件,调用Vue.js提供的API和工具。

5. 调试和优化

在完成小程序Vue转化之后,我们需要进行调试和优化。小程序Vue转化工具可能存在一些兼容性和性能问题,需要进行优化和调试。

四、总结

小程序Vue转化是将Vue.js的组件转化为小程序的组件,实现两种不同框架之间的互通。在转化过程中,需要解决小程序和Vue.js的生命周期、UI渲染机制和组件系统之间的差异。小程序Vue转化可以提高开发效率和代码复用性,适用于需要同时开发小程序和Web应用的开发者。


相关知识:
阿里小程序开发工具下载
阿里小程序是一款基于阿里云开发平台的小程序开发工具,可以方便地开发、测试和部署小程序。很多开发者都希望了解如何下载阿里小程序开发工具,本文将为您详细介绍这个过程。首先,您需要前往阿里云开发者中心的小程序开发页面(https://next.aliyun.co
2023-08-09
安徽地铁查询小程序开发
随着城市建设的不断发展,地铁成为人们出行的主要方式之一。为了方便地铁出行人员的查询和乘车,安徽地铁查询小程序应运而生。下面来介绍一下开发这个小程序的原理或详细介绍。一、搭建小程序框架安徽地铁查询小程序的开发离不开小程序的框架,因此,首先要搭建小程序的框架。
2023-08-09
安庆求职招聘小程序开发
安庆是一个美丽的城市,也是一个经济发展迅速的区域。这里有着不少的工作机会,同时也有着越来越多的求职者。为了更好的帮助企业和求职者更好的匹配,开发一个安庆求职招聘小程序是非常有意义的。一、实现原理安庆求职招聘小程序的实现原理如下:1.前后端分离安庆求职招聘小
2023-08-09
安亭微信小程序运营开发
随着微信小程序的普及和发展,越来越多的企业、机构以及个人开始重视微信小程序的开发和运营。其中,安亭微信小程序运营开发是比较热门的一个方向,本文将着重介绍安亭微信小程序运营开发的原理和详细步骤。一、安亭微信小程序概述安亭微信小程序是指安亭商圈(AnTing
2023-08-09
tp5
TP5.1是目前比较热门的PHP框架,其集成了丰富的类库和工具,能够方便地实现各种功能。微信小程序支付是一种线上交易方式,开发人员可以利用微信小程序提供的API接口实现该功能。本文将详细介绍如何在TP5.1中开发微信小程序支付功能。1.准备工作在开发微信小
2023-08-09
ios 微信小程序开发工具
iOS 微信小程序开发工具是由腾讯微信团队推出的一款针对 iOS 设备的小程序开发工具,它提供了一种快速、简单、便捷的开发方式,让开发者能够更加轻松地开发出小程序程序。下面我来详细介绍一下 iOS 微信小程序开发工具的原理和功能。iOS 微信小程序开发工具
2023-08-09
h5和小程序的开发要注意什么
H5和小程序是目前互联网领域两种非常热门的开发方式。下面将从原理和开发要注意的几个方面详细介绍H5和小程序的开发。一、H5开发的原理H5全称为HTML5,是超文本标记语言第五个版本。从原理上来说,H5本质上是一个由HTML、CSS和JavaScript三大
2023-08-09
b2c类似淘宝的小程序模板开发
B2C类似淘宝的小程序是一种电子商务平台,它提供了一个能够让用户在一个统一的平台上浏览、搜索并购买商品的功能。这种小程序的目的是为了帮助商家快速入驻一个平台,提供商品、管理订单,并实现销售的目标。开发B2C类似淘宝的小程序需要按照以下几个步骤进行:1. 设
2023-08-09
小程序开发工具怎么下载
小程序开发工具是开发微信小程序的必备工具之一。本文将从下载过程和原理两个方面进行详细介绍。一、下载过程为了下载小程序开发工具,你需要进行以下步骤:1.打开微信开发者工具的官方网站,网址是:developers.weixin.qq.com/miniprogr
2023-05-26
微信小程序开发工具一定要联网
微信小程序开发工具是一款面向开发者的应用程序,可以帮助开发者轻松开发、测试、调试和发布微信小程序。对于很多开发者而言,他们会有这样的问题:微信小程序开发工具一定要联网吗?答案是肯定的,微信小程序开发工具必须联网才能工作。下面我将为大家详细介绍微信小程序开发
2023-05-26
东莞一个微信小程序开发工具公司是哪家
东莞是中国南部一个重要的城市,也是一个重要的制造业城市。在这个城市里,有很多优秀的IT企业,其中包括一家微信小程序开发工具公司。这家公司专注于提供高品质的微信小程序开发工具,帮助各种规模的企业快速开发和推广小程序。这家公司的名字叫做“创易无限(东莞)科技有
2023-05-22
百色企业小程序开发工具有哪些
百色企业小程序开发工具主要有以下几种:1. 微信开发者工具微信开发者工具是开发和调试小程序的官方工具。提供了一个模拟器,可以实时预览小程序效果。同时也提供了代码编辑器、调试工具等开发必需工具。使用微信开发者工具,开发小程序就像开发网页一样方便快捷。2. I
2023-05-22